About

Yulianto Yulianto is a scholar working on Information Systems, Demography and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Yulianto Yulianto has authored 41 papers receiving a total of 67 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Information Systems, 8 papers in Demography and 7 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Yulianto Yulianto’s work include SMEs Development and Digital Marketing (8 papers), Blockchain Technology in Education and Learning (6 papers) and Educational Methods and Media Use (5 papers). Yulianto Yulianto is often cited by papers focused on SMEs Development and Digital Marketing (8 papers), Blockchain Technology in Education and Learning (6 papers) and Educational Methods and Media Use (5 papers). Yulianto Yulianto collaborates with scholars based in Indonesia, Russia and Australia. Yulianto Yulianto's co-authors include Eka Purnama Harahap, Haris Kamal, Susi Ari Kristina, Richard O. Day, Luh Putu Lila Wulandari, Marco Liverani, Matthew Law, Tri Wibawa, Mishal Khan and Neha Batura and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et Regional Health - Western Pacific, Global Journal of Health Science and Humanities & Social Sciences Reviews.
